Summary

  • Equity markets faced significant declines, with the S&P 500 down over -2.5% last week, and major sectors like Consumer Discretionary and Info Tech driving the losses.
  • Closed-End Funds (CEFs) saw modest discount widening, with PIMCO funds like PTY, PDO, and PAXS becoming cheaper, presenting potential buying opportunities.
  • Franklin Universal Trust hit 52-week highs but may face headwinds; consider trimming positions, especially given its underperformance against the XLU sector ETF.
  • Notable corporate actions include distribution changes for abrdn Emerging Markets Ex-China and Blackstone funds, and a merger between abrdn Japan Equity and abrdn Global Infra Inc.

Macro Picture

The equity markets had another bad week with the S&P 500 losing just over -2.5%. That takes this month's decline to over -8% and the YTD decline at -4.42%. The Nasdaq fell a similar amount last week but is down -11.5% for the month and -8.2% for the year....
